Ducati India launches all-new 2025 Streetfighter V2 with advanced features

The ‘Fight Formula’ arrives in India with the new Ducati Streetfighter V2, inheriting the Panigale V2's essence and mischievous spirit. Available with two variants: Streetfighter V2 and Streetfighter V2 S

Ducati IndiaLuxury motorcycle brand Ducati launched the highly anticipated Ducati Streetfighter V2 in India.

Applying Ducati’s renowned “Fight Formula” to the Panigale V2 platform, this new naked sportbike delivers an exhilarating blend of cutting-edge technology, aggressive design, and accessible performance for both road and track enthusiasts.

Design & Ergonomics

The Streetfighter V2 retrieves the typical stylistic features of the Streetfighter family. The sharp and menacing “look” of the front, traced by the Full-LED headlights and DRL, makes an immediately recognizable profile. The rear, completely faired in continuity with the front, creates a monolithic effect between the seat and the tail, recalling the Desmosedici MotoGP and underlining the bike’s sporty soul. The new six-spoke light alloy wheels, with a “Y” profile, are finished in black, perfectly complementing the full Ducati Red livery.

Ergonomics have been meticulously designed for both support and comfort. The rider’s seat, at 838 mm, allows for easy footing, while the fuel tank’s ergonomic shape provides crucial support during braking and cornering, reducing physical effort.

The New V2 Engine

At the core of the Streetfighter V2 is the new 90° V2 engine, 890 cc and Euro5+ homologated. Weighing a mere 54.4 kg, it is the lightest twin-cylinder ever produced by Ducati. It delivers a maximum power of 120 hp at 10,750 rpm and a maximum torque of 93.3 Nm at 8,250 rpm. Its generous power delivery, with over 70% of maximum torque available at just 3,000 rpm, ensures an exciting response at every throttle opening. For track enthusiasts, a racing exhaust is available as an accessory, increasing power to 126 hp and reducing weight by 4.5 kg.

The six-speed transmission features the second-generation Ducati Quick Shift (DQS) 2.0, providing a more direct and precise gear shift feel. An oil bath slipper clutch with progressive hydraulic control ensures a light lever pull, enhancing riding pleasure.

Unrivaled Chassis & Handling

The Streetfighter V2 is built around a lightweight and efficient monocoque frame, using the V2 engine as a stressed element. This compact and rational solution contributes to the bike’s impressive dry weight of 175 kg (Streetfighter V2 S) and 178 kg (Streetfighter V2), making it the lightest Streetfighter ever produced.

SuperSport-Derived Electronics

The Streetfighter V2 is equipped with a state-of-the-art electronics package, featuring a 6-axis IMU inertial platform for comprehensive control and safety. This includes:

  • ABS Cornering: With a “slide by brake” function for controlled sliding into corners.
  • Ducati Traction Control (DTC): With a new “predictive” control strategy for enhanced grip management.
  • Ducati Wheelie Control (DWC): For maximum acceleration performance with safety.
  • Ducati Quick Shift (DQS) 2.0: For seamless up and down shifts.
  • Engine Brake Control (EBC): To optimize stability during aggressive braking.

Riders can instantly adapt the bike’s behavior by choosing from four Riding Modes (Race, Sport, Road, Wet), each offering pre-configured and user-modifiable intervention levels for all controls and engine response. The new 5” TFT dashboard provides a clear and intuitive rider interface, with three display modes (Road, Road Pro, Track) to suit different riding contexts.

The Ducati Streetfighter V2 and Streetfighter V2 S will be available in India in striking Ducati Red livery starting  27th November 2025. The price is fixed at Streetfighter V2: INR 17,50,200 and Streetfighter V2 S: INR 19,48,900 (Ex-Showroom India)
